

Deciding to quit drinking is frequently the hardest component of treatment, but it is not constantly the safest part. For people who have actually been consuming heavily for months or years, the body can respond greatly when alcohol is removed. Trembling, sweating, anxiousness, nausea, confusion, increasing blood pressure, and seizures can all show up during withdrawal. In the most serious situations, alcohol withdrawal can end up being life-threatening. That is why clinical alcohol detoxification matters, especially for anyone with a long background of everyday drinking, prior withdrawal issues, or co-occurring medical issues.

Alcohol affects the central nervous system in a way that can make withdrawal distinctly hazardous. Gradually, the mind adapts to alcohol's depressant impacts. When drinking quits instantly, the nerves can rebound into overactivity. That is why a person may begin with shakes and sleeplessness, then proceed to frustration, hallucinations, or seizures. Timing differs, however signs and symptoms typically begin within several hours after the last beverage, escalate over the first one to three days, and in many cases proceed longer.
Not everybody needs inpatient care, yet many individuals undervalue their risk. I have seen people insist they just drink white wine, or that they only consume in the night, then show up with heart rates over 120, extreme dehydration, and high blood pressure high sufficient to prompt instant issue. Quantity matters, however pattern matters as well. Daily alcohol consumption, early morning alcohol consumption, repeated stopped working efforts to give up, previous detoxification episodes, and use various other compounds can all boost the chance of a rough withdrawal.
The other issue is unpredictability. A person may look reasonably stable at consumption and still deteriorate later on. That is one factor inpatient alcohol detoxification remains the conventional recommendation for people at moderate to high threat. In a proper clinical setup, signs can be treated early as opposed to after a dilemma starts.
An inpatient alcohol detoxification program is generally the safest choice for people that consume alcohol greatly or have a history that suggests difficult withdrawal. That consists of individuals that have actually had seizures, ecstasy tremens, blackouts, drops, or emergency clinic check outs connected to alcohol. It also includes those with liver condition, heart problem, pancreatitis, improperly managed diabetes, anxiety with self-destructive thoughts, or concurrent use of benzodiazepines or opioids.
Age can matter as well. Older adults usually have less physical get, even more medications, and a greater threat of dehydration or complication. Young adults are not immune either. It is not unusual for a person in their late twenties or thirties to arrive in far worse form than expected because alcohol usage has been blended with energy drinks, rest help, or anti-anxiety pills.

The very first day of clinical alcohol detox is focused on assessment. Before medicine choices are made, the group requires a clear clinical photo. Consumption usually consists of a thorough history of drinking patterns, prior withdrawals, existing symptoms, various other materials used, psychological wellness background, and medical problems. Vitals are checked right away. Staff will certainly often ask when the last drink was, just how much was eaten on a regular day, whether there have been past seizures, and whether the patient has been consuming or sleeping.
Lab job is common in many inpatient setups because alcohol usage can impact electrolytes, liver function, blood counts, and hydration status. Some clients likewise require screening for infection, pregnancy, or co-occurring drug use. None of this is meant to be invasive for its very own sake. It helps the medical group make a decision exactly how aggressive surveillance needs to be and whether there are quiet problems that need timely attention.

Once admitted, the prompt goal is stabilization. That typically includes liquids, nutritional support, sign monitoring, and drug to avoid or lower withdrawal difficulties. One of the most important clinical information in alcohol detoxification is thiamine replacement. Hefty alcohol use can deplete thiamine and increase the risk of significant neurological injury. It is a routine part of great detox care, though several patients do not recognize why they are receiving it.
Medication protocols vary. Some facilities use symptom-triggered techniques, meaning medication is provided based upon the extent of withdrawal indicators. Others make use of scheduled application for higher-risk situations. Benzodiazepines are typically made use of due to the fact that they help relax the nervous system and decrease the risk of seizures. In selected situations, clinicians may include various other drugs for high blood pressure, nausea, sleep, or anxiety. The specific program depends on age, liver function, co-occurring conditions, and exactly how the person reacts over time.
During this period, surveillance is constant. Nurses might check vitals a number of times via the night and day. Sleep can be fragmented initially. Some people are amazed by exactly how literally intense the very early phase feels. Even with drug, the body might still drink, sweat, affordable alcohol rehab and pains. That does not indicate detox is stopping working. It implies the nervous system is altering after sustained alcohol exposure.
Many symptoms of alcohol withdrawal are unpleasant however anticipated. inpatient alcohol detox Palm Beach Gardens Stress and anxiety, tremblings, irritation, queasiness, insomnia, anorexia nervosa, migraine, and sweating prevail. People usually claim they feel uneasy in their own skin. That summary is clinically useful because it catches the nerves overstimulation that rests at the center of withdrawal.
A smaller sized team of signs and symptoms signals greater risk and demands close observation. These include severe disorientation, visual or responsive hallucinations, repeated throwing up, unpredictable blood pressure, high temperature, seizure activity, or intensifying anxiety that does not work out with routine treatment. Delirium tremens, commonly shortened to DTs, is the been afraid issue several families have read about. It does not occur in every case, yet when it does, it is a clinical emergency situation defined by profound complication, free instability, and often hallucinations.
One functional point deserves highlighting. The lack of dramatic symptoms in the first few hours does not assure a light detoxification. Some serious issues arise later. That is detox for alcohol withdrawal one factor a credible medical alcohol detoxification program does not rely upon a solitary picture at admission. It watches fads, not simply moments.

Detox is not practically medication. It is likewise concerning matching the level of like the actual individual before you.
The physical signs and symptoms get the majority of the focus, but the emotional swing of early soberness can be intense. Alcohol frequently functions as an unrefined regulatory authority. It blunts stress, numbs despair, silences social stress and anxiety, or knocks out sleep, till it quits working and starts producing much more issues than it covers up. When alcohol is gotten rid of, those underlying concerns can hurry back prior to the patient has any type of healthy coping tools in place.
That is why individuals in inpatient alcohol detoxification may appear in tears, irritable, taken out, or unexpectedly stressed. Some feel alleviation within a day or two. Others really feel raw. It is not uncommon for a person to say, midway through detoxification, that they did not understand exactly how anxious they had come to be due to the fact that alcohol consumption had actually become their standard. For families, this can be complicated. They expect the client to really alcohol addiction therapy feel grateful or positive when assist begins. Often the very first emotional truth is exhaustion.
Good programs stabilize this without lessening it. They screen for depression, suicidality, injury history, and other psychiatric issues. They likewise avoid making grand promises during the detox window. Recovery can begin there, yet detoxification itself is just the opening phase.
There is no set timeline that fits every person. Lots of clients full alcohol detox in about 3 to seven days, though some demand longer. Intensity of dependence, age, clinical status, rest deprivation, and use various other materials all impact period. An individual with light to modest signs and symptoms and no significant clinical concerns may maintain relatively quickly. Somebody with duplicated prior detoxification episodes, severe crucial indication instability, or liver disability may require a much more extensive course.
The phrase that matters is medically secure, not simply alcohol-free. A patient can have no alcohol left in the blood stream and still be medically unready for discharge. Rest, orientation, hunger, high blood pressure, stride, and psychological standing all matter. Rushing out too soon can increase the opportunity of relapse or medical setback.
One of the most common blunders is treating detox as the goal. It is not. It is the clinical bridge that obtains an individual securely via withdrawal so they can start actual therapy. Without follow-up care, relapse rates climb rapidly, typically within days. That is not due to the fact that the person fell short. It is since detox eliminates alcohol, not the factors alcohol ended up being central in the first place.
Most people leaving inpatient detoxification are motivated to enter an organized next degree of care. That could mean residential treatment, partial hospitalization, extensive outpatient treatment, or a carefully handled outpatient strategy with therapy and medication support. The right step depends upon professional need, home stability, regression history, transportation, and household involvement.

That first week after detoxification is commonly much more delicate than individuals anticipate. Food cravings might rise as the body begins to recoup. Rest can remain disrupted. Feelings can feel unequal. If an individual returns to the same setting, very same stressors, and very same routines without structure, the pull toward alcohol consumption can be strong.

Alcohol is generally eliminated from the bloodstream within about 24 hours after the last drink, although the exact timing depends on factors such as body size, liver function, and the amount consumed. Recovery from the physical effects of heavy alcohol use may take much longer. Withdrawal symptoms can last several days. Long-term healing continues after alcohol is no longer present in the body.
The cost of alcohol detox depends on the level of medical care, length of stay, and insurance coverage. Without insurance, expenses can range from several hundred to several thousand dollars. Many health insurance plans cover medically necessary detox services. Additional treatment after detox may involve separate costs.

Inpatient alcohol detox provides 24-hour medical supervision while the body adjusts to the absence of alcohol. Medical staff monitor withdrawal symptoms and may provide medications, fluids, nutritional support, and regular health assessments when appropriate. The goal is to manage withdrawal safely and reduce complications. Patients are often evaluated for continued treatment after detox.
Alcohol detox in a supervised facility typically lasts between 3 and 7 days. The exact length depends on the severity of alcohol dependence, withdrawal symptoms, and overall health. Some individuals require additional monitoring if symptoms are severe. Detox is often followed by ongoing counseling or rehabilitation.
After seven days without alcohol, many people notice improvements in hydration, sleep quality, and mental clarity. Early withdrawal symptoms often begin to decrease during this period. Some individuals also experience improved energy levels and concentration. Results vary depending on previous drinking habits and overall health.
For most people, alcohol is fully eliminated from the bloodstream within approximately 24 hours after the last drink. The exact time depends on metabolism, liver function, and the amount of alcohol consumed. Different testing methods may detect alcohol or its byproducts for varying lengths of time. Recovery from alcohol use continues after the alcohol has been eliminated.
Around the third day of alcohol detox, withdrawal symptoms may begin to improve for many people, although some continue to experience discomfort. In severe cases, serious complications such as seizures or delirium tremens are most likely to occur during the first few days. Medical supervision is important for individuals at risk of severe withdrawal. Recovery progresses differently for each person.
